In addition to its Washington, D.C. staff, FAS has a global network of nearly 100 offices … WebThe law was originally drafted by future Foreign Agricultural Service (FAS) administrator Gwynn Garnett after returning from a trip to India in 1950. The bill is unusual in that it gave the FAS the ability to conclude agreements with foreign governments without the approval of the United States Senate. WebUSDA Regulation 1051-001 (June 2005) defines the role of the Foreign Agricultural Service as the Department’s lead agency in coordinating all agricultural matters with foreign countries. WebThe FAS, through IPAD, provides agricultural information for global food security. It produces objective, timely and regular assessments of global agricultural production outlook and the conditions affecting food security. WebThe Farm and Foreign Agricultural Services mission area was divided into the mission areas of Farm Production and Conservation (FPAC) and Trade and Foreign Agricultural Affairs, completing the creation of an Undersecretary of Agriculture for Trade and Foreign Agricultural Affairs which was mandated by the 2014 Farm Bill . In 1894, USDA created a Section of Foreign Markets in its Division of Statistics, which by 1901 numbered seven employees. See more In 1934, Congress passed the Reciprocal Trade Agreements Act, which stipulated that the President must consult with the Secretary of Agriculture when negotiating tariff reductions for agricultural commodities.
